Rapist sentenced to life and 15 years in prison

By Teboho Moloi

QWAQWA – A 30-year-old man from Boiketlo village in Namahadi has been sentenced to life imprisonment for rape and an additional 15 years for attempted murder by the Phuthaditjhaba Magistrates’ Court.

Themba Malinga was sentenced on Thursday, 6 August, after being found guilty of raping a 25-year-old woman and attempting to kill her.

The incident occurred on 16 August four years ago when the victim was walking alone near a tavern. Malinga confronted her, and she recognised him.

During the trial, the court heard that Malinga covered the woman’s mouth with his hand before dragging her to a nearby donga. He instructed her to undress and raped her.

He then took the victim to his residence, where he continued to rape her several times during the night.

According to police spokesperson Warrant Officer Mmako Mophiring, the victim told police that at approximately 04:00 the following morning, Malinga attacked her with a broken beer bottle, seriously injuring her neck.

Malinga then fled the scene without providing assistance.Despite her injuries, the victim managed to reach a nearby house, where residents assisted her before she was taken to hospital.

Mophiring said Malinga was traced in 2022 but could not be arrested at the time.

“He was eventually arrested in 2025 after the victim unexpectedly came across him. She immediately went to the police station and reported his whereabouts. He was arrested, denied bail and remained in custody while the matter proceeded through court,” said Mophiring.

Free State Provincial Commissioner Lieutenant General Thabang Lesia welcomed the sentence, saying it sends a strong message that crimes against women and children remain a priority for law enforcement and the criminal justice system.

The sentence brings the case to a close after years of waiting for justice for the victim.
